legongju.com
我们一直在努力
2025-01-15 22:10 | 星期三

C语言中info的存储方式

在C语言中,info的存储方式取决于info的数据类型和使用的存储位置。info可以存储在内存中的堆、栈或全局数据区中。

如果info是一个局部变量,则它通常会存储在栈上,随着函数的执行而分配和释放。

如果info是一个全局变量,则它会存储在全局数据区中,程序在运行时一直存在。

如果info是一个动态分配的变量,可以使用malloc()或calloc()函数在堆中分配内存,并通过指针来访问这段内存。

总之,info的存储方式取决于其数据类型和使用的存储位置,可以是栈上、堆上或全局数据区中。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/110631.html

相关推荐

  • C语言中string的存储结构是怎样的

    C语言中string的存储结构是怎样的

    在C语言中,字符串通常以字符数组的形式存储。每个字符都被存储在数组的一个位置上,并以null字符(‘\0’)作为结尾标志。这意味着字符串的长度可以动态变化,但必...

  • 在C语言中处理string的常用方法有哪些

    在C语言中处理string的常用方法有哪些

    在C语言中处理string的常用方法包括以下几种: 使用char数组:在C语言中,字符串通常被表示为char类型的字符数组。可以使用char数组来存储和操作字符串数据。 使...

  • C语言如何实现类似string的功能

    C语言如何实现类似string的功能

    在C语言中,可以使用字符数组和相关的字符串处理函数来实现类似string的功能。以下是一些实现string功能的常用方法: 使用字符数组:
    可以使用字符数组来存...

  • C语言中string库函数的使用示例

    C语言中string库函数的使用示例

    #include #include int main() {
    char str1[20] = “Hello”;
    char str2[20] = “World”;
    // 将str2拼接到str1的末尾
    strcat(str1, str2);...

  • C#中字符串的存储与内存占用分析

    C#中字符串的存储与内存占用分析

    在C#中,字符串是不可变的数据类型,即一旦创建就不能被修改。当创建一个字符串变量时,实际上是在内存中分配一个指向字符串值的引用。字符串的值存储在托管堆中...

  • java的json数据存储策略

    java的json数据存储策略

    在Java中,可以使用各种不同的库来处理JSON数据,比如Jackson、Gson、FastJson等。这些库提供了不同的方法和策略来存储JSON数据。以下是一些常见的JSON数据存储策...

  • 如何实现mysql的二叉树索引

    如何实现mysql的二叉树索引

    要在MySQL中实现二叉树索引,可以使用索引的B-tree结构来构建二叉树。具体步骤如下: 创建表格时,确保要创建的字段是树的节点,并为该字段创建索引。 CREATE TA...

  • mysql二叉树索引的优势是什么

    mysql二叉树索引的优势是什么

    MySQL二叉树索引的优势包括: 提高查询性能:二叉树索引可以快速定位到符合查询条件的数据行,减少了数据库的扫描和比较次数,从而提高了查询性能。 支持范围查询...